Advantages: New aluminum construction looks good, feels solid; attractive edge-to-edge glass display Disadvantages: Still no ExpressCard or SD card slot;
Apple's redesigned 13-inch Mac Book is essentially a shrunken version of the more expensive 15-inch Pro line. With its new aluminum body, new track pad, and Nvidia graphics, it's an even more attractive choice for mainstream laptop buyers than was the plastic model it replaces.
